Reporting to the Supervisor, Home and Community Care, the Home and Community Care Worker II is a member of the Home and Community Care Team and is in frequent contact with the client and family. The Home and Community Care Worker II provides a key link to observe the client’s condition and any changes in their support network. The Home and Community Care Worker II reports any changes in the client’s condition to the Supervisor Home and Community Care or the Program Supervisor in the community.
The Home and Community Care Worker II ensure that all client, family and program information, records and communication are treated with strict confidentiality; carry out the client care and/or service plans by following the pre-determined task list; assist clients with activities of daily living according to the care plan and task list. This may include bathing, grooming, dressing toileting, providing medication reminders and ambulation, including assistance with walking, climbing stairs and getting in and out of bed; perform specialized tasks or activities of daily living following individualized, client-specific training. These may include special care for palliative, rehabilitation and post-acute clients; prepare nourishing meals and special diets as required; plan meals with the client and assist client with grocery shopping; perform light housekeeping duties; assist in activities of daily living, other than personal care, where the client may have difficulties, such a watering plants, feeding pets, etc.; light laundry and essential mending of clothing for the client; record data appropriately, accurately, completely and in a timely way to ensure clean and accurate client and employee records; observe the client’s condition, needs and environment on an ongoing basis and report changes to the Supervisor Home and Community Care or Program Supervisor in the community; report changes in planned hours of service to the Program Supervisor; follow Health and Safety regulations and protocols; treat everyone in a respectful manner; participate in staff meetings, conferences and in-service training; maintain ongoing written records and call/communities with client; assist with medical interpretation for the Home Care Nurse; and maintain strict client confidentiality.
The knowledge, skills and abilities are typically acquired through a completion of Grade 10 education and two years of home care experience.

The Aging at Home (AAH) program is a service delivery program to assist seniors 55+ who need assistance to be able to remain living independently in their own home. The heart of the Aging at Home program is delivery of services such as friendly visiting and home supports which includes light house-keeping, meal prep, friendly visiting, laundry and supportive transportation services (grocery, banking, pharmacy). The AAH Coordinator will support access to gas cards for specialized medical appointment calculated based on pre-determined program variables. Included in the duties is the coordination and tracking of contracted services that would provide lawn care and/or snow removal.

In 1993, the Métis Nation of Ontario (MNO) was established through the will of Métis people and Métis communities coming together throughout Ontario to create a Métis-specific governance structure and vision, encapsulated in the Statement of Prime Purpose. Today, the Métis Nation of Ontario represents over 25,000 Métis citizens.
The MNO delivers programs and services to its citizens through these branches: Healing and Wellness; Community Wellbeing; Education and Training; Housing; Lands, Resources and Consultation; Intergovernmental and Community Relations; Self-Government and Registry. Through these various branches, the MNO maintains 30+ offices and community spaces across the province, administers over $50 million annually, and employs about 350 staff across the province.

New Directions is a social service agency offering a wide range of resources and services that foster people’s hopes and dreams in their communities. Supported Independent Living (S.I.L.) is one of the many services offered by New Directions. S.I.L. provides independent living supports to people who may have intellectual disabilities and/or mental health issues, and who experience barriers to living independently in the community. Home support workers provide personal care and companionship for seniors, persons with disabilities and convalescent clients. Care is provided within the client's residence, in which the home support worker may also reside. They are employed by home care and support agencies, private households, or they may be self-employed. Housekeepers perform housekeeping and other home management duties in private households and other non-institutional, residential settings.
